Consider the quadratic function y= x^2+x-2
\n" ); document.write( "Determine
\n" ); document.write( "a)the y-intercept
\n" ); document.write( "Let x = 0, then y = -2
\n" ); document.write( "--------------------------------
\n" ); document.write( "b) the axis of symmetry
\n" ); document.write( "Complete the square:
\n" ); document.write( "x^2+x+(1/2)^2 = y+2+(1/2)^2
\n" ); document.write( "(x+(1/2))^2 = y+(9/4)
\n" ); document.write( "Axis at x = -1/2
\n" ); document.write( "---------------------------
\n" ); document.write( "c)the x-intercepts
\n" ); document.write( "Solve: x^2+x-2 = 0
\n" ); document.write( "Factor: (x+2)(x-1) = 0
\n" ); document.write( "x = 1 or x = -2
\n" ); document.write( "-----------------------------
\n" ); document.write( "d)the vertex
\n" ); document.write( "Use (x+(1/2))^2 = y+(9/4)
\n" ); document.write( "Vertex at (-1/2,-9/4)
